Al Roker shows Oswego love as he leaves hospital, misses Thanksgiving parade<\/b><\/p>\n

SUNY Oswego alumnus Al Roker showed his alma mater some love on Thursday as he left the hospital after being treated for a blood clot in his leg and lungs. Roker posted a video of himself walking down a hospital hallway while wearing a green, yellow and gray Oswego State polo shirt.<\/p>\n

\u201cAll right, this is my version of the Thanksgiving Day Parade,\u201d he said. \u201cGetting ready to leave the hospital. Time to blow this taco stand. Woohoo!\u201d<\/p>\n

The \u201cToday\u201d show weatherman missed the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ade for the first time in 27 years, but said he got home in time to watch a little of the NBC broadcast while still wearing his Oswego shirt.<\/p>\n

Roker and NBC did not say when he expects to be back on TV, but he looked to be in high spirits Thursday and later shared a photo from turkey dinner with his family. The 68-year-old broadcaster has dealt with a number of health issues in recent years, including prostate cancer, a shoulder surgery due to arthritis in 2020 and a hip replacement in 2019.<\/p>\n

Roker started his TV career in Syracuse at WHEN-TV, now known as CNY Central’s WTVH-5, in 1974 while still a student at Oswego State. He’s has been at the \u201cToday\u201d show for more than 25 years as a weatherman and co-host of the NBC morning show’s \u201c3rd Hour Today,\u201d on top of hosting shows on the Food Network and the Weather Channel, plus acting in movies and TV shows like \u201cZombieland: Double Tap,\u201d \u201cSharknado 5,\u201d \u201cKung Fu Panda 3,\u201d \u201cThe Simpsons,\u201d \u201cSeinfeld\u201d and \u201cCloudy with a Chance of Meatballs.\u201d<\/p>\n
